Ethanol blending shaping self reliance
The case for ethanol blending is real. India imports roughly 85% of its crude oil. Every litre of petrol that ethanol displaces is a litre we do not have to buy from the ever-changing global markets, especially now when West Asia tensions are keeping supply chains at bottlenecks and anxious. The government says the blending programme has already saved nearly ₹1.85 lakh crore in foreign exchange. NITI Aayog’s own life-cycle study found that sugarcane-based ethanol emits 65% fewer greenhouse gases than petrol. These are not small numbers.
Add to this the farmer angle. Ethanol is largely produced from sugarcane and surplus grain. Payments of over ₹40,600 crore have reportedly gone to farmers through the programme. For a country where agricultural distress has long been a crisis, a policy that creates steady, government-backed demand for farm produce is genuinely valuable. I do not think critics should dismiss this so casually.

The Bigger picture
The NITI Aayog’s own 2021 roadmap, the foundational document behind this entire programme recommended that E20-tuned vehicles be available in the market from April 2025, and that lower ethanol blends should continue to be available for older vehicles during the transition. Neither happened on schedule. The government made E20 mandatory across all pumps before a significant share of the fleet was compatible, and quietly removed E5 and E10 from most stations, leaving older vehicle owners with no alternative.
The same report projected a mileage loss of 6 to 7% for four-wheelers not calibrated for E20, and 3 to 4% for two-wheelers. It recommended pricing ethanol-blended fuel lower than regular petrol to compensate consumers. That recommendation was also not implemented for E20 the blended fuel was sold at the same price as the petrol it replaced, even though it delivers less energy per litre.
A survey covering over 42,000 vehicle owners across 316 districts found that 52% have spent ₹5,000 or more in additional fuel and repair costs since the E20 rollout. Nearly three in ten reported unusual engine wear. These are not just few complaints , these are consequences of rolling out a fuel blend without completing the necessary ground work, that were predicted long before by the government’s own experts and researchers.
The E85 Blend comes into the frame
Then there is the E85 question. E85 is not just a higher blend; it is an entirely different proposition. It cannot be used in regular petrol engines at all. It requires flex-fuel vehicles with specially upgraded injectors, fuel pumps, sensors, and engine calibration. Right now, the only mass-market car that supports E85 is the newly unveiled Maruti Suzuki Wagon R Flex Fuel, which is currently available only for commercial fleet operators. Hero MotoCorp has launched flex-fuel versions of the Splendor+ and HF Deluxe. For everyone else, which is nearly everyone: E85 is, at this moment, irrelevant.
The government has priced E85 at roughly ₹20 cheaper per litre than E20, and frames this as a consumer benefit. But E85 delivers about 25 to 30% fewer kilometres per litre than petrol. Brazil, which has run the world’s most successful ethanol programme for over four decades, uses a simple consumer rule: ethanol is only worth it if it costs less than 70% of petrol’s price. At that threshold, the mileage loss is offset by the savings. India has no equivalent transparency mechanism at pumps. Consumers are expected to calculate this themselves or simply trust the government’s framing.
What needs to be done
None of this means the policy should be scrapped, it means it needs to be done in the right order. Restore lower ethanol blends as an option for pre-2023 vehicles while the fleet naturally transitions. Price E20 lower than regular petrol, as NITI Aayog recommended five years ago. Display cost-per-kilometre figures at every E85 pump so consumers can make a real choice. Create a modest subsidy for middle-class vehicle owners to upgrade fuel system components on older bikes and cars. And reduce dependence on sugarcane: a crop that requires nearly 2,860 litres of water to produce one litre of ethanol by scaling up second-generation ethanol from crop residue and agricultural waste.
Brazil took four decades to build its ethanol ecosystem. India is trying to do it in four years. The ambition is admirable. But my neighbour’s bike is running on a policy that was not quite ready for him, and he, like most middle-class Indians, had no say in that decision.
The spirit of this transition is right. The sequence just needs to catch up.
